The Air University Library at Muir S. Fairchild Research Information Center
on Maxwell Air Force Base, is seeking individuals with an MLIS from an
accredited university to serve a Periodicals Librarian. 

 

The GS-1410-09 position in periodicals is finally open on the USAJOBS.gov
<http://usajobs.gov>  website! The direct link is: 

 

Under the direct supervision of the Chief of Periodicals, the successful
applicant will perform detailed work for Periodicals Section including
processing new, current, and retiring print and electronic journals;
assisting with binding; re-shelving bound volumes; updating databases, Word
files, and spreadsheets; tabulating statistics; and serving at the reference
desk. There will be some night duty (Library is open 0730-2100 Mon-Thurs, &
0730-1700 Friday) and Saturday scheduling, which is shared by the reference
team. A security clearance is required. 

The applicant should also be able to form strong working relationships with
students and faculty, assist in answering reference questions as well as
other academic needs, provide support to the reference desk, cooperate well
within a team oriented  environment, among other project duties as assigned.
